    Abstract
    This paper discusses two inter-related themes: the retrieval potential of faceted thesauri and XML representations of fundamental facets. Initial findings are discussed from the ongoing 'FACET' project, in collaboration with the National Museum of Science and Industry. The work discussed seeks to take advantage of the structure afforded by faceted systems for multi-term queries and flexible matching, focusing in this paper an the Art and Architecture Thesaurus. A multi-term matching function yields ranked results with partial matches via semantic term expansion, based an a measure of distance over the semantic index space formed by thesaurus relationships. Our intention is to drive the system from general representations and a common query structure and interface. To this end, we are developing an XML representation based an work by the Classification Research Group an fundamental facets or categories. The XML representation maps categories to particular thesauri and hierarchies. The system interface, which is configured by the mapping, incorporates a thesaurus browser with navigation history together with a term search facility and drag and drop query builder.

    Abstract
    Experimental evidence suggests that enhancing the subject content of OPAC records can improve retrieval performance. This is based on the use of natural language index terms derived from the table of contents and back-of-the-book index of documents. The research reported here investigates the alternative approach of translating these natural language terms into controlled vocabulary. Subject queries were collected by interview at the catalogue, and indexing of the queries demonstrated the impressive ability of PRECIS, and to a lesser extent LCSH, to represent users' information needs. DDC performed poorly in this respect. The assumption was made that an index language adequately specific to represent users' queries should be adequate to represent document contents. Searches were carried out on three test databases, and both natural language and PRECIS enhancement of MARC records increased the number of relevant documents found, with PRECIS showing the better performance. However, with weak stemming the advantage of PRECIS was lost. Consideration must also be given to the potential advantages of controlled vocabulary, over and above basic retrieval performance measures

    Abstract
    Authority files have played an important role in improving the quality of indexing and subject cataloging. Although authorities can significantly improve search by increasing the number of access points, they are rarely an integral part of the information retrieval process, particularly end-users searches. A retrieval prototype, searchFAST, was developed to test the feasibility of using an authority file as an index to bibliographic records. searchFAST uses FAST (Faceted Application of Subject Terminology) as an index to OCLC's WorldCat.org bibliographic database. The searchFAST methodology complements, rather than replaces, existing WorldCat.org access. The bibliographic file is searched indirectly; first the authority file is searched to identify appropriate subject headings, then the headings are used to retrieve the matching bibliographic records. The prototype demonstrates the effectiveness and practicality of using an authority file as an index. Searching the authority file leverages authority control work by increasing the number of access points while supporting a simple interface designed for end-users.

    Abstract
    The paper looks at ways in which traditional classification and indexing tools have dealt with the relationships between constituent terms; variations in these are examined and compared with the methods used in machine searching, particularly of the Internet and World Wide Web. Apparent correspondences with features of index languages are identified, and further methods of applying classification and indexing theory to machine retrieval are proposed. There are various ways in which indexing and retrieval systems, both conventional and electronic, deal with the problem of searching for documents on a subject basis, and various approaches to the analysis and processing of a query. There appear to be three basic models; the taxonomic or structural system, in which the user is offered a map of the `universe of knowledge'; the language based system, which offers a vocabulary of the subject and a grammar for dealing with compound statements; and the mathematical model using the language of symbolic logic or the algebra of set theory

    Abstract
    This article reports on a comparison of the postcoordinate retrieval effectiveness of two indexing languages: LCSH and PRECIS. The effect of augmenting each with title words was also studies. The database for the study was over 15.000 UK MARC records. Users returned 5.326 relevant judgements for citations retrieved for 61 SDI profiles, representing a wide variety of subjects. Results are reported in terms of precision and relative recall. Pure/applied sciences data and social science data were analyzed separately. Cochran's significance tests for ratios were used to interpret the findings. Recall emerged as the more important measure discriminating the behavior of the two languages. Addition of title words was found to improve recall of both indexing languages significantly. A direct relationship was observed between recall and exhaustivity. For the social sciences searches, recalls from PRECIS alone and from PRECIS with title words were significantly higher than those from LCSH alone and from LCSH with title words, respectively. Corresponding comparisons for the pure/applied sciences searches revealed no significant differences

    Abstract
    Although subject hierarchies are widely used to index document collections, few tools leverage their structure to facilitate collection browsing. This is mostly due to the complexity of such structures that include thousands of nodes. This paper proposes a new approach to simplify subject hierarchies based on the distribution of documents among the nodes. A random walk algorithm simulates the route of a user within the hierarchy, under the assumption that the user is attracted by the most populated nodes. Poorly visited nodes can be identified and eliminated, leaving a structure containing only the nodes that best represent the content of the collection. Experiments on a collection indexed using the Library of Congress Subject Headings (LCSH) show that, as compared to the state-of-the-art simplification method, the random walk-based approach gives access to a larger part of the collection for the same structure size, and offers more flexibility to customize the complexity of thestructure.
